ConsenSys-owned crypto pockets supplier MetaMask has despatched out a warning to the group concerning Apple iCloud phishing assaults.
The safety subject for iPhone, Mac, and iPad customers is said to default machine settings which see a consumer’s seed phrase or “password-encrypted MetaMask vault” saved on the iCloud if the consumer has enabled computerized backups for his or her app knowledge.
In a Twitter thread posted on April 18, MetaMask famous that customers run the chance of shedding their funds if their Apple password “isn’t robust sufficient” and an attacker is ready to phish their account credentials.
To repair the problem, customers can disable computerized iCloud backups for MetaMask as detailed:

The warning from MetaMask got here in response to experiences from an NFT collector who goes by “revive_dom” on Twitter, who stated on April 15 that their total pockets containing $650,000 price of digital belongings and NFTs was wiped through this particular safety subject.
In a separate thread earlier right this moment, DAPE NFT mission founder “Serpent” – who additionally helped achieve the eye of MetaMask through posting sharing the story with their 277,000 followers — gave a rundown of what occurred to the sufferer.
They famous that the sufferer acquired a number of textual content messages asking to reset his Apple ID password together with a supposed name from Apple which was finally a spoofed caller ID.
As they have been reportedly unsuspecting of the caller, “revive_dom” handed over a six-digit verification code to show that they have been the proprietor of the Apple account. The scammers subsequently hung up and accessed his MetaMask account through knowledge saved on iCloud.

After MetaMask posted the warning right this moment, “revive_dom” expressed his frustrations with the corporate, noting that:
“I’m not saying they shouldn’t do it however they need to inform us. Don’t inform us to by no means retailer our seed phrase digitally after which do it behind our backs. If 90% of the folks knew this I’d guess none of them would have the app or iCloud on.”
Whereas many of the group response was supportive, others have been fast to emphasise the significance of utilizing chilly storage and doing quite a lot of due diligence when storing belongings in a scorching pockets.
